The Dugout Discussion – Sunday

Although Sunday beckons in just two Premier League fixtures, there are plenty of points at stake as four sides rich in Fantasy talent do battle. Everton play host to Manchester United in the lunchtime kick off, with the Red Devils looking to cast aside their defeat to Chelsea and snap the Toffees’ five-match unbeaten streak. Arsenal’s home clash against the Blues caps headlines the weekend’s action, with Jose Mourinho’s men all but securing the Premier League crown in the event of an Emirates win.

Everton welcome United to Goodison Park in search of their fifth victory in six outings. Roberto Martinez’s side have been particularly resilient at Goodison in recent weeks and have served up five clean sheets in the last six in front of their own fans, as Leighton Baines and Seamus Coleman make a late scramble up the Fantasy standings. United are now enjoying goals from midfield, with Juan Mata (three in four), Marouane Fellaini (two in five) and Ander Herrera (two in three) all contributing to the cause.

The team news from Goodison is significant for both sides. Everton hand a start to striker Romelu Lukaku after he saw action as a substitute in the win over Burnley last time out. Leon Osman also returns to the teamsheet as Kevin Mirallas and Arouna Kone drop to the bench. As for United, they are able to welcome back Daley Blind to the midfield engine room, allowing Wayne Rooney to shift to the attack against his former club: Radamel Falcao makes way.

Sunday’s main event promises to be a tight affair that could become attritional; Arsenal and Chelsea have both conceded just seven goals in their previous 12 matches and it’s fair to say that Jose Mourinho’s side will be containing the Gunners threat as a first priority. Arsenal have recorded eight straight wins since a 2-1 loss to Tottenham Hotspur back in early February, with Olivier Giroud’s red-hot form (seven goals in as many starts) driving their success. With two goals and three assists in four league outings, Aaron Ramsey is showing glimpses of least season’s breakthrough star. Eden Hazard has delivered attacking returns in 13 of his last 17 appearances and promises to keep Arsenal occupied at the back.
